Rakuten interview question

How to reverse a string without using extra memory?

Interview Answers

Anonymous

6 Mar 2014

I have never heard of it before that time. I think there are some answers on the web about it

1

Anonymous

23 Jun 2015

Print recursively..

Anonymous

24 Oct 2016

public void reverse(char s[]){ for(int i=0,j=s.length-1;i<=j;i++,j--){ s[i] ^= s[j]; s[i] ^= (s[j] ^= s[i]); } }